I was extremely surprised at this show. I was expecting something low-key with Cute is What We Aim for "headlining," but what we got was actually better. The first opening band, Made Violent, was absolutely great! It ended up being a post-pop-punk show in a very clean venue with a well-stocked bar. The place wasn't packed by any means, which meant that every place you stood had a clear view of the band. My only critique is that the sound was really only rigged for the first band, as the mics were a bit hazy for the second band (who I couldn't understand at all) and Cute is What We Aim For. Loved the night overall though.

I've been to numerous CiWWAF concerts and I have to say that this was by far the best. Although the venue was small and the acoustics left something to be desired, the band put on an amazing show. There is something so contagious about watching someone who is geniunely talented having so much fun on stage; my friends and I couldn't help but sing and dance along! I know that the band has had some recent turmoil, however I definitely believe that CiWWAF emerged out of everything better than ever. I'm particularly impressed given that this is the first real show of the tour and that all of the band (aka everyone but the lead singer) was new. Overall, I'm keeping my fingers crossed that they come back to Boston soon because I'm ready to go again!
